Mausklick in einem DCGET abfragen [ERLEDIGT]

Moderator: Moderatoren

Antworten
Benutzeravatar
Manfred
Foren-Administrator
Foren-Administrator
Beiträge: 21186
Registriert: Di, 29. Nov 2005 16:58
Wohnort: Kreis Wesel
Hat sich bedankt: 210 Mal
Danksagung erhalten: 67 Mal

Mausklick in einem DCGET abfragen [ERLEDIGT]

Beitrag von Manfred »

Hi,

wie kann ich eigentlich einstellen, das irgendwas aufgerufen wird, wenn ich mit der Maustaste in ein DCGET klicke?
Zuletzt geändert von Manfred am Mi, 09. Sep 2009 20:14, insgesamt 1-mal geändert.
Gruß Manfred
Mitglied der XUG Osnabrück
Schatzmeister des Deutschsprachige Xbase-Entwickler e.V.
großer Fan des Xbaseentwicklerwiki https://wiki.xbaseentwickler.de/index.p ... Hauptseite
Doof kann man sein, man muß sich nur zu helfen wissen!!
Benutzeravatar
Tom
Der Entwickler von "Deep Thought"
Der Entwickler von "Deep Thought"
Beiträge: 9357
Registriert: Do, 22. Sep 2005 23:11
Wohnort: Berlin
Hat sich bedankt: 101 Mal
Danksagung erhalten: 361 Mal
Kontaktdaten:

Re: Mausklick in einem DCGET abfragen

Beitrag von Tom »

Code: Alles auswählen

@ n,n DCGET db->feld EVAL {|o|o:LbClick := {||MsgBox('Linke Maustaste')}}
Herzlich,
Tom
Benutzeravatar
Manfred
Foren-Administrator
Foren-Administrator
Beiträge: 21186
Registriert: Di, 29. Nov 2005 16:58
Wohnort: Kreis Wesel
Hat sich bedankt: 210 Mal
Danksagung erhalten: 67 Mal

Re: Mausklick in einem DCGET abfragen

Beitrag von Manfred »

Hi Tom,

danke. Ich dachte da wäre was von Roger vorgesehen. Auf diese einfache Sache bin ich mal wieder nicht gekommen. #-o
Gruß Manfred
Mitglied der XUG Osnabrück
Schatzmeister des Deutschsprachige Xbase-Entwickler e.V.
großer Fan des Xbaseentwicklerwiki https://wiki.xbaseentwickler.de/index.p ... Hauptseite
Doof kann man sein, man muß sich nur zu helfen wissen!!
Benutzeravatar
Tom
Der Entwickler von "Deep Thought"
Der Entwickler von "Deep Thought"
Beiträge: 9357
Registriert: Do, 22. Sep 2005 23:11
Wohnort: Berlin
Hat sich bedankt: 101 Mal
Danksagung erhalten: 361 Mal
Kontaktdaten:

Re: Mausklick in einem DCGET abfragen

Beitrag von Tom »

So ist es einfacher, zumal es einen ganzen Haufen Events gibt, die man abfragen könnte.

Aber - Vorsicht: Es kann sein (ich habe es nicht ausprobiert), dass man dieserart die Slotinhalte überlagert, die Roger selbst hinterlegt. Sollte das der Fall sein, wäre so etwas hilfreich:

Code: Alles auswählen

o:LbClick := DC_MergeBlocks(o:LbClick,{||MsgBox('Linke Maustaste')})
DC_Mergeblocks hängt an dieser Stellte an den bestehenden Inhalt des :LbClick-Slots den MsgBox-Codeblock - vorausgesetzt, da ist schon was drin.
Herzlich,
Tom
Benutzeravatar
Manfred
Foren-Administrator
Foren-Administrator
Beiträge: 21186
Registriert: Di, 29. Nov 2005 16:58
Wohnort: Kreis Wesel
Hat sich bedankt: 210 Mal
Danksagung erhalten: 67 Mal

Re: Mausklick in einem DCGET abfragen

Beitrag von Manfred »

OK,

werde ich mir merken. Das war aber schon recht hilfreich. Ich denke mal da kommt in diesem Bereich nichts mehr bei. Ist nur so ein Service von mir. Ich schlag damit 2 Fliegen mit einer Klappe. 3 Suchfelder, die automatisch den Index umschalten und dann in der DB suchen und dann den Browse refreshen. Da ich jetzt zu faul bin das über den Header zu regeln per Mausklick, rufe ich einfach per Mausklick in dem DCGET die Suchoption aus dem DCGet auf, die ich auch nach dem Verlassen aufrufe. Nur da dann das/die DCGET leer sind, wir nur der Index umgeschaltet und neu angezeigt. Gefällt mir auf den 1.Blick recht gut. mal sehen, was der Anwender dazu sagt.
Gruß Manfred
Mitglied der XUG Osnabrück
Schatzmeister des Deutschsprachige Xbase-Entwickler e.V.
großer Fan des Xbaseentwicklerwiki https://wiki.xbaseentwickler.de/index.p ... Hauptseite
Doof kann man sein, man muß sich nur zu helfen wissen!!
Benutzeravatar
Tom
Der Entwickler von "Deep Thought"
Der Entwickler von "Deep Thought"
Beiträge: 9357
Registriert: Do, 22. Sep 2005 23:11
Wohnort: Berlin
Hat sich bedankt: 101 Mal
Danksagung erhalten: 361 Mal
Kontaktdaten:

Re: Mausklick in einem DCGET abfragen [ERLEDIGT]

Beitrag von Tom »

Mmh.

Die GETs können aber auch auf anderem Weg den Fokus bekommen. Dafür gibt's - wie immer - GOTFOCUS und LOSTFOCUS.
Herzlich,
Tom
Benutzeravatar
Manfred
Foren-Administrator
Foren-Administrator
Beiträge: 21186
Registriert: Di, 29. Nov 2005 16:58
Wohnort: Kreis Wesel
Hat sich bedankt: 210 Mal
Danksagung erhalten: 67 Mal

Re: Mausklick in einem DCGET abfragen [ERLEDIGT]

Beitrag von Manfred »

es geht nicht um den Fokus. Es geht um den Mausklick....
Daran hatte ich nämlich auch gedacht.
Aber jetzt werde ich erstmal sehen, wie das in der Praxis klappt.
Gruß Manfred
Mitglied der XUG Osnabrück
Schatzmeister des Deutschsprachige Xbase-Entwickler e.V.
großer Fan des Xbaseentwicklerwiki https://wiki.xbaseentwickler.de/index.p ... Hauptseite
Doof kann man sein, man muß sich nur zu helfen wissen!!
Antworten